This is the Eleventh Amendment to Interlocal Agreement, made
and entered into by and between: BROWARD COUNTY, a political
subdivision of the state of Florida, hereinafter referred to as
"COUNTY,"
AND
CITY OF TAMARAC, a municipal corporation, existing under the
laws of the state of Florida, hereinafter referred to as "CITY."
WHEREAS, Section 336.025(1)(b), Florida Statutes, authorizes
the counties to extend the levy of the six (6) cent local option
gas tax upon every gallon of motor fuel and special fuel sold in
Broward County for a period not to exceed thirty (30) years on a
majority vote of the governing body of the COUNTY; and
WHEREAS, on June 14, 1988, the Board of County Commissioners
enacted Ordinance No. 88-27, effective September 1, 1988, through
August 31, 2018, pursuant to Section 336.025(1)(b), Florida
Statutes, extending the levy of the six cent local option gas tax
for thirty years and providing for a method of distribution of the
proceeds of the tax; and
WHEREAS, pursuant to said ordinance, the method for
distribution of the proceeds is the execution of an interlocal
agreement with one or more of the municipalities representing a
majority of the population of the incorporated area within the
county which establishes the distribution formulas for dividing the
proceeds of the tax among the county and all eligible
municipalities within the county, as set forth in Section
336.025(3)(a)l., Florida Statutes; and
R-9Y-39
WHEREAS, paragraph 4 of the Interlocal Agreement, as amended
by the Addendum to the Interlocal Agreement, requires annual
adjustment of the population of the individual municipalities and
unincorporated Broward County in accordance with the population
figures set forth in the most current edition of "Florida Estimates
of Population," published by the Bureau of Economics and Business
Research, Population Division, University of Florida; NOW,
THEREFORE,
IN CONSIDERATION of the mutual terms, conditions, promises,
covenants and payments hereinafter set forth, COUNTY and CITY agree
as follows:
1. Paragraph 2 of the Interlocal Agreement, as amended by the
Addendum thereto and the Tenth Amendment to Interlocal
Agreement, is amended to read as follows:
2. Sixty-two and one-half percent (62.5%) of said Local
Option Gas Tax proceeds shall be distributed to the
COUNTY, and the remaining thirty-seven and one-half
percent (37.5%) shall be divided among and distributed to
the eligible municipalities within the COUNTY as follows:
